About Shift Writing Into The Classroom With UDL And

Every Teacher's Guide to Writing across the Curriculum This book is an essential resource for all educators. To address declining literacy skills, every educator needs to become a teacher of writing. In every grade and subject, the writing process enables students to interpret complex ideas, cultivate their individual voices, and shape and share their learning. As writing becomes more efficient with the aid of AI chatbots, there's an unparalleled opportunity for educators across all content areas to reimagine their approach to writing. In Shift Writing into the Classroom, UDL and blended learning experts Catlin R. Tucker and Katie Novak invite educators to focus on human connection, sitting alongside learners to understand their specific needs and provide individualized instruction and support across all grades and content areas. Tucker and Novak transform traditional writing workflows to provide students with meaningful opportunities in the classroom to work through the writing process, collaborate with peers, and produce original writing that addresses task, purpose, and audience creatively and authentically. Ideal for schools and districts prioritizing the integration of literacy across the curriculum, this book offers practical guidance, strategies, and resources to elevate students' writing abilities in every subject.
